My figurative sculptures draw inspiration from historical references, mythology, and everyday life. Old World/New World influences play an important role in my art. Having spent half of my life in Transylvania and the other half in Canada I experience a certain duality that provides an insight to reflect upon the fundamental aspects of our very existence. My sculptures are the result of an intuitive process that functions as a bridge between the real and an alternative world that provides a necessary outlet for my thoughts and imagination. I started working in papier mache in 2007. My interest grew over the years as I continuously searched for new ways of using this underrated but versatile material. It is a great pleasure to see the art community embrace papier mache as a versatile fine art medium. |
